Common Culture Trellis Netting is an effective and economical way to support climbing vegetables and heavy crops using its versatile polypropylene mesh. Common Culture Trellis Netting is a resistant but lightweight trellis between and over gardens, flower beds or hydroponic systems. Common Culture Trellis Netting facilitates the desired growth form of lush vegetables, rich foliage, and beautiful flowering plants. Theromoplastic product subject to +/-5% variations in size. Extruded and stretched in hot water, roll may contain moisture and condensation which affect neither the product nor the crop.
Due to its durability and practical nature, Common Culture Trellis Netting is being used by many agriculturalists and floriculturists. Common Culture Trellis Netting works extremely well for a variety of growing techniques, both vertical and horizontal. It is easy to handle, simple to install and will not tangle. 6 in x 6 in reach-through holes. Heavy-duty, long-lasting trellis netting features 6″ reach-through mesh that allows the trellis to handle more weight, remain taut, and provide strong support for growing crops.
